Blakelaw is a residential suburb in Newcastle that occupies the western part of the city. The neighbourhood extends across an accessible area served by local bus routes and sits within walking distance of local shops and community facilities. Housing stock ranges from traditional terraced properties to more modern residential developments, characteristic of Newcastle’s inner suburban belt.
The suburb functions as a quiet, family-oriented neighbourhood with tree-lined streets and green spaces that provide respite from the wider urban environment. Residents and visitors benefit from straightforward connections to Newcastle city centre and the broader transport network, making it a practical base for those seeking suburban living without excessive distance from city amenities.
